摘要
Vanadate has been reported to be involved in the causation of cancer. In this study, we found that both AP-1 and NF kappa-B activities were increased after treatment with sodium vanadate in JB6 cells. Maximum induction of AP-1 and NF kappa B appeared at 48 to 72 h. Phosphorylations of Erks and p38 kinases were markedly increased at 100 mu M of vanadate. while phosphorylation of JNKs was not affected, Vanadate also enhances the phosphorylation of I kappa B alpha. These results suggest that the activation of AP-1 and NF kappa B by vanadate may be mediated through enhancement of phosphorylation of Erk/p38 kinases and I kappa B alpha. respectively.
